A chart that shows the number of Google searches for each Pokรฉmon. The text says: In honor of Pokรฉmon Day, ACE.com, the free-to-play social gaming website, has analyzed Pokรฉmon-related Google search data across the United States over the last 36 months to determine fans' favorite characters. Rank Name Generation Monthly searches 1 Pikachu Generation 1 685,100 2 Flamigo Generation 9 374,600 3 Charizard Generation 1 310,900 4 Charmeleon Generation 1 250,400 5 Squirtle Generation 1 215,800 6 Eevee Generation 1 214,500 7 Mewtwo Generation 1 209,100 8 Snorlax Generation 1 207,600 9 Gengar Generation 1 192,100 10 Ditto Generation 1 175,500 11 Bulbasaur Generation 1 171,600 12 Charmander Generation 1 169,400 13 Grafaiai Generation 9 166,900 14 Gardevoir Generation 3 149,800 15 Lopunny Generation 4 144,900

Another tip on closing <dialog>s involves the new `closedby` attribute. Putting `closedby="any"` on a <dialog> adds light-dismiss functionality to the dialog, meaning users can close the dialog with the Esc keyboard shortcut.

#Ruby namespace will be renamed to `Ruby::Box`
An MR about this was merged to the Ruby master a couple of days ago

In case you missed the news - #Ruby 3.5 is going to become Ruby 4.0 to celebrate the 30th Ruby anniversary github.com/ruby/ruby/co...
It's a bit odd to make such a decision only a month and half before the release (Christmas day), but it is how it is.
